1. What is a defence union?
A defence union is a military alliance between countries for collective defense and security cooperation, aimed at enhancing their defense capabilities and promoting peace and stability.
2. How does a defence union differ from a traditional military alliance?
A defence union goes beyond a traditional military alliance by integrating defense policies, procurement, and capabilities, leading to a higher level of cooperation and coordination among member countries.
3. What are the benefits of a defence union?
Benefits of a defence union include increased efficiency in defense spending, improved interoperability among member armed forces, and enhanced deterrence against potential threats.
4. How does a defence union contribute to regional security?
A defence union strengthens regional security by fostering closer military cooperation, sharing intelligence, and coordinating responses to security challenges and crises in the region.
5. Are there any challenges to forming a defence union?
Challenges to forming a defence union may include differing national interests, concerns about sovereignty, and the need for consensus among member countries on defense policies and decision-making.
